Overview

After their teacher announces a good citizenship contest, Shelby and her classmates try to outdo each other with good deeds. Grand plans go wrong and sometimes backfire, but then Shelby does something truly good without thinking of any award. When the prize isn't quite what anyone expects, she and her friends have a laugh and decide helping others feels better than getting an award.

About the Author

D.L. Green lives in California with her husband, three children, silly dog, and a big collection of rubber chickens. She loves to read, write, and joke around.

Illustrator Leandra La Rosa lives and works in Palermo, Sicily. She was born in Trapani, a town on the island’s western side, and since childhood her main interests have been illustration, animation, and music. Leandra studied at the Academy of Fine Arts in Palermo and obtained a degree in graphic design. Since 2013 she has been working as a graphic designer and illustrator for many Italian agencies and publishing houses.
